Siberian Anthracite signs latest PXF

Siberian Anthracite signed its latest pre-export facility – a $570 million five-year deal – on 22 December 2017. Launched around October 2017 and led by ING (facility agent), the deal includes the following bank takes: ING Bank is providing $145 million, Sberbank $120...
